Title: Data Center Technician
Location: Fort Lauderdale, FL
Key Responsibilities:
- Installation and Maintenance:
Install, configure, and maintain servers, storage systems, network equipment, and other data centre hardware.
- Monitoring and Troubleshooting:
Monitor the performance of data Center systems, identify and resolve technical issues, and ensure optimal uptime.
- Physical Infrastructure: Manage the physical infrastructure of the data centre, including power, cooling, and cabling.
- Security: Implement and maintain security measures to protect data and systems from unauthorized access and threats.
- Documentation: Maintain accurate records of system configurations, changes, and troubleshooting procedures.
- Collaboration: Work with other IT staff, vendors, and contractors to ensure smooth operations.
- Staying Up to Date: Keep abreast of the latest technologies and best practices in data centre operations.
Skills and Qualifications:
- Technical Skills: Strong understanding of server hardware, networking protocols, operating systems, and virtualization technologies.
- Troubleshooting and Problem-Solving: Ability to diagnose and resolve technical issues quickly and effectively.
- Physical Dexterity: Ability to work in a data centre environment, including lifting and moving equipment.
- Communication Skills: Ability to communicate technical information clearly and concisely.
- Certifications: Relevant certifications (e.g., CompTIA Server+, Cisco certifications) can be beneficial.
